> It seems that hotmail addresses sending to my qmail toaster resend mail
> over and over.  I see something like 10 copies of the same message. I
> think we have narrowed it down to SPF headers like this.  Please look at
> the two headers below:

>=== SNIPPED A LOT ===<

> Identical messages - just redelivered. No clue as to why - this seems to
> plague hotmail mainly.  The machine is not under pressure - not 
> swapping, etc.  The mail is from an EZMLM list that I host - all the 
> recipients see these duplicates, so it is annoying.

Why do you think that this is SPF related trouble? Headers above
shows, that a message has passed SPF tests, that means that DNS query
was successful. Even if it were not, timeout for DNS query typically
is set to 10 seconds, so it's not the reason for other party to drop
connection and resend a message later.
Even more, SPF get's checked just after 'MAIL FROM:' issue from other
party, and it the connection were timing out at this moment, there
would be no message at all to reach your qq handler.

If I were you, I'd temporarily turned off SpamAssassin (or disabled
bayest tests and learning completely in local.cf), as the common cause
for connections to time out after a DATA sequence is a way to long
time SA takes to check a message in several rare conditions.
